One game added to late penalty
Actions resulted from an incident near the end of the Latvia-Slovakia game on April 17.
Latvian forward Rudolfs Builis will miss the first game of his team’s relegation-round series on Thursday against Belarus.
In the game two days ago against Slovakia, Builis received a five-minute major for checking to the head and neck as well as an automatic game misconduct. The incident occurred with 1:10 remaining in a game the Slovaks won, 4-0.
A video review of the incident by the Directorate Chairman confirmed that supplementary discipline to Builis would be appropriate. As a result, the player has received an additional suspension of one game.
Builis will be eligible to return for game two of the relegation series on Friday.
